Only find the vertex and axis of symmetry
lara [203]

Answer:

vertex (5,2)

axis of symmetry: x=5

Step-by-step explanation:

vertex (h,k)

y = a(x - h)² + k

f(x)=(x-5)²+2        a = 1     h = 5      k = 2

vertex (5 , 2)

The axis of symmetry always passes through the vertex of the parabola. The x -coordinate of the vertex is the equation of the axis of symmetry of the parabola.

x = 5

Find all the integers,b, that make up the trinomial x2 + bx + 10 factorable.
KonstantinChe [14]

By the fundamental theorem of algebra, we can write

x^2+bx+10=(x-r_1)(x-r_2)

Expanding the right hand side, we get

x^2+bx+10=x^2-(r_1+r_2)x+r_1r_2\implies\begin{cases}r_1+r_2=-b\\r_1r_2=10\end{cases}

We want b to be an integer, which means r_1,r_2 must also be integers. This means r_1,r_2 must be factors of 10. There are several possibilities:

r_1=\pm10,r_2=\pm1\implies b=-(10+1)=-11\text{ or }b=-(-10-1)=11

r_1=\pm5,r_2=\pm2\implies b=-(5+2)=-7\text{ or }b=-(-5-2)=7

So there are 4 possible values for b: -11, -7, 7, and 11.
